SHANNON BRIDGE.
PETITION TO PARLIAMENT. Wellington, July 10. “(Shannon bridge is ;not in a good position and is likely to be swept away by flood.” That is the statement contained in a petition presented to Parliament and a large number of residens ask that the bridge, which spans the Manawatu river between Shannon and Foxton, shoiild receive the attention of the House. Portion of the bridge was destroyed by flood waters in Nevember last and the span has not been replaced.
